According to a report in the Turkish press, Trabonspor is still reportedly interested in Burnley striker Wout Weghorst.

The Netherlands international is rumored to be leaving Turf Moor this summer, with many teams interested in signing him.

Weghorst is reportedly taking decisive action to quit Burnley after considering his options following Euro 2024, according to Baskatip. Trabzonspor is reportedly among the teams with the best chance to sign the player this month.

According to reports, the Championship team is willing to pay a club around €10 million to sign the Dutchman.
Weghorst is a free agent, and Trabzonspor will have competition from Ajax, who wants to allow him to go back to his native country. Rangers, a huge Scottish team, have also been connected to the former Manchester United player recently.

The Championship team will be under pressure to let him go this summer or risk losing him on a free agent next summer, as he only has a year left on his deal.

Weghorst previously spent a brief loan at Besiktas in Turkey during the 2022–2023 season.
